Study Notes
Fare Structure of Different Classes
- Minimum fare, rounding off fare, inflated distance, and combined fares are considered.
- Minimum chargeable distance and other charges vary by class (Rupees per adult passenger).
- Fares are valid as of January 1, 2020.
- Data includes class, chargeable distance (km), minimum fare (Rs), reservation fee (Rs), and supplementary charge (Rs).
Class Specific Fares
- AC/Busy Season: I AC class - 300 km, 1059 Rs, 60 Rs, 75 Rs.
- AC/Lean Season: I AC - 300 km, 998 Rs, 60 Rs, 75 Rs.
- 2AC/Busy Season: 300 km, 625 Rs, 50 Rs, 45 Rs.
- 2AC/Lean Season: 300 km, 605 Rs, 50 Rs, 45 Rs.
- Ist Class M/Exp: 100 km, 232 Rs, 50 Rs, 45 Rs.
- Ist Class Ordy: 100 km, 232 Rs, 50 Rs, 45 Rs.
- AC III (Economy): 300 km, 440 Rs, 40 Rs, 45 Rs.
- AC Chair Car: 150 km, 211 Rs, 20 Rs, 30 Rs.
- Sleeper Class M/Exp: 200 km, 124 Rs, 20 Rs, 30 Rs.
- Sleeper Class Ordy: 200 km, 78 Rs, 20 Rs, 15 Rs.
- II Class M/E: 50 km, 30 Rs, 15 Rs, 15 Rs.
- II Class Ordy, Non-Suburban: 10 km, 10 Rs, 15 Rs, -
- II Class Ordy, Suburban: 10 km, 5 Rs, -, -
Important Notes
- Minimum fares apply to adults and children, but not to PTO or concessional fares.
- Children under 5 years travel free.
- Children 5-12 years old pay half the adult fare (minimum fare applies).
- Child fare is dependent on reserved seating needs
Additional Notes (Page 2)
- Children in unreserved classes are charged half the adult fare (but not less than minimum fare).
- Reserved classes charge full adult fare if a berth is required.
- Reserved classes charge half adult fare if a berth isn't required (no reservation fee),
- Full adult fare applies to children in reserved chair cars.
Additional Notes (Page 3)
- Minimum chargeable fare in non-suburban sections is Rs.10.
- Basic fare applies to child tickets (unreserved).
- Concessional and PTO fares might be less than minimum basic fare.
- GST of 5% applies to first and all AC classes.
